Union Industries, the leading manufacturer of bespoke high-speed industrial doors, has helped LoneStar Leeds Limited, a world-class provider of precision engineered components, sealing technologies and specialised coatings and plating reduce costs and improve efficiency through the triple installation of its Bulldoor.

Union Industries was first approached by LoneStar in 2023 and was subsequently tasked with providing solutions for site enhancement projects at its facilities, primarily on doorways frequently accessed by forklift trucks for deliveries and stock movement. The three Bulldoors were designated for deployment across LoneStar’s two sites in Leeds.

Headquartered in the West Midlands, UK, and employing more than 1,000 people across 13 sites, LoneStar Group has proven itself in global logistics. It utilises a worldwide network of its own manufacturing and distribution operations, as well as primary supply sources, to supply and support customers in America, Europe, the Middle East, Central and South East Asia and Australia with precision engineered components.

The primary objective was to mitigate heat loss within the premises, thereby reducing energy expenditure and improving the company’s ECG performance. The existing roller shutters and sectional overhead security doors, characterised by slow operational speeds, often remained open, resulting in substantial heat dissipation and increased energy consumption, especially during harsh weather conditions.

Union Industries developed tailored solutions for each opening, including reducing the opening size of a large doorway to curtail heat loss while maintaining optimal clear opening sizes to suit LoneStar’s requirements. Additionally, it crafted a door to fit within tight spatial constraints without compromising operational functionality. Importantly, all three doors seamlessly integrated with existing security measures, ensuring comprehensive site security post working hours.

Like other doors in their range, Bulldoor also benefits from Union’s simple yet proven ‘Crash Out and Auto-Reset’ facility, in case of vehicle impact to the bottom beam, thus ensuring minimal downtime and repair costs.
